WebMore than one path can get you there. The key is to figure out what you want to do and make a road map to reach your destination. Most jobs require at least a high school diploma. Other jobs require some education or training after high school. You may need an associate’s, bachelor’s, master’s, or more advanced degree for some careers. WebSome teens don’t feel ready for college directly after high school. One option for them is a “gap year.”. A gap year is becoming more common among American students. And many colleges will now allow students to defer enrollment for a year. Many students spend their gap year exploring interests through internships, volunteer experiences, a ...
